Mr Soren's counsel appealed that his client be shifted to RIMS. Public Prosecutor Anil Mahto contended that the reason behind shifting him to RIMS was not clear as earlier medical reports recommended rest for the incarcerated JMM leader. The court sought details mentioning whether treatment of Mr Soren was possible in Dumka and fixed March 15 as the next date for hearing.

It was recommended to send him to RIMS for the tests as the district lacked the required equipment for such examinations, Dr Hembrom said.

Soren had failed to appear before the Jamtara, Dumka and Giridih courts relating to various cases in the past few weeks after citing ill health.

He was shifted to Dumka jail amid controversy after a Jamtara court ordered to put him at Jamtara jail only.

Last month he could not appear in the court because of swelling in his legs besides other ailments.

Jharkhand Janadhikar Manch march to Raj Bhavan on delimitation

Ranchi, Feb 26 (UNI) The Jharkhand Janadhikar Manch today marched to Raj Bhavan here expressing concern over the Delimitation Commission's proposal to reduce SC/ST seats besides exclusion of dome town areas in Ranchi and Jamshedpur from scheduled areas.

Hundreds of JJM activists from diffrent districts gathered at the historic Morabadi ground and took out a rally that culminated near the Raj Bhavan.

The rally then turned into a public meeting where several speakers expressed their views.

First woman mayor for RMC

Rajahmundry, Feb 26 (UNI) Ms Adireddy Veera Raghavamma of the Telugu Desam Party (TDP) was today unanimously elected as the first woman mayor of Rajahmundry Municipal Corporation (RMC) here.

During the election, 31 corporators raised their hands in support of Ms Raghavamma.

Election Special Officer and East Godavari Collector M Subramanyam administered oath of office and secrecy to 50 corporators earlier.

Later, Mr B S Prasad also of the TDP was unanimously elected as deputy mayor.

TN CM failed to protect basic rights on Cauvery water: Vaiko

Coimbatore, Feb 26 (UNI) MDMK general secretary Vaiko today alleged that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M Karunanidhi had failed to protect the basic rights of the state on the sharing of river waters before the Cauvery Water Dispute Tribunal.

Talking to newspersons here, he said immediately after the Tribunal gave its Final verdict on the water issue, Mr Karunanidhi had announced that the state had got its due share. However, he changed his stand later on the issue.

Newly elected Councillors sworn in

Chennai, Feb 26 (UNI) The newly elected councillors of the Chennai Corporation, except four DMDK members, were sworn in today.

The Corporation Commissioner Rajesh Lakhoni administered the oath of office in the presence of Deputy Mayor R Sathyabama.

Councillor Sardar, who had defected to DMK after getting elected in DMDK ticket from Ward 27, also took oath.

The former Mayor M Subramanian, who was elected unopposed, was the first to take the oath.
